Kinds Of Printer Paper
Understanding the different kinds of printer paper is vital for selecting the right one for your needs. Below is a comprehensive table laying out numerous typical types of printer paper, their characteristics, and suitable usages.
| Type of Paper | Attributes | Finest Used For |
|---|---|---|
| Standard A4 Copy Paper Promo Paper | Intense white, 20 pound weight, smooth finish | Daily printing, files, memos |
| Image Paper | Glossy or matte finish, heavier weight | Top quality picture prints |
| Cardstock | Thick, sturdy, readily available in numerous colors | Invitations, business cards, crafts |
| Resume Paper | Premium finish, typically much heavier than standard paper | Resumes, cover letters, professional documents |
| Labels | Adhesive paper, can be printed on with routine printers | Sticker labels, address labels, item labels |
| Legal Paper | Legal-sized, smooth surface, typically heavier weight | Legal documents, agreements |
| Specialized Paper | Numerous textures and surfaces (e.g., linen, parchment) | Art prints, greeting cards, special tasks |
1. Standard Copy Paper
Basic copy paper is created for everyday printing requirements. It is intense white, smooth in texture, and usually weighs around 20 pounds. This paper is best for printing text files, memos, and other basic documents.
2. Picture Paper
For those who value print quality, picture paper is necessary. Offered in glossy and matte finishes, picture paper is generally much heavier than routine paper, making it perfect for high-resolution images and dynamic colors.
3. Cardstock
Cardstock is thicker and stronger than basic paper, which makes it ideal for printing organization cards, invites, and crafting jobs. Its numerous colors and textures can boost the visual appeal of printed materials.
4. Resume Paper
When printing expert documents, resume paper is an excellent choice. Typically much heavier than standard copy paper and of premium quality, this paper communicates professionalism and care in presentation.
5. Labels
Label paper is specially developed for printing stickers and labels. It features an adhesive backing and can be formatted to fit standard printer settings. This paper is ideal for developing shipping labels, address labels, or custom sticker labels.
6. Legal Paper
Legal-sized paper is bigger than basic letter-sized paper and is typically utilized for official documents such as agreements and legal briefs. This kind of paper is normally smooth and can deal with high-quality printing.
7. Specialty Paper
Specialized paper includes a range of textures and finishes, including linen and parchment. This kind of paper is often used for art prints, greeting cards, and other special jobs that need a touch of beauty.

2. Paper Weight
Paper weight is determined in pounds (pounds) and affects its density and toughness. For basic printing, a weight of 20 pounds suffices, whereas image printing may need paper weights of 30 lbs or more.
3. End up Type
The finish of the paper (glossy, matte, or textured) significantly affects the last print quality. Glossy surfaces are ideal for pictures, while matte finishes provide a more suppressed look suitable for text-heavy documents.
4. Size
Be sure to choose the proper size of paper for your printer. Common sizes include letter (8.5" x 11"), legal (8.5" x 14"), and A4 Copy Paper Stock (8.27" x 11.69"). Ensuring compatibility with your printer design is necessary to avoid paper jams or misprints.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I use routine copy paper for image printing?
While regular copy paper can be used for basic picture printing, it will not produce the exact same quality as devoted photo paper. Utilizing photo paper makes sure lively colors and sharper images.
2. How do I know if the paper will deal with my printer?
Constantly examine your printer's specifications for suitable paper types and sizes. A lot of printer manufacturers offer guidelines on the kinds of paper that work best.
3. Is it worth purchasing specialized paper?
If you prepare to print items like welcoming cards or art prints, specialized paper can enhance the overall look of your jobs. The investment can pay off in regards to quality.
4. What is the distinction in between glossy and matte paper?
Shiny paper has a shiny finish that enhances colors, making it ideal for photos. Matte paper has a non-reflective surface, which is better for text documents or art prints that require a more subtle look.

5. Can I find environment-friendly printer paper online?
Yes, numerous merchants now offer eco-friendly printer paper made from recycled products. Search for documents identified as "recycled" or "sustainable" for environmentally-conscious choices.
